The Queen of May

Title: The Queen of May
Description: The Queen of May is an exuberant springtime landscape painting with wild flowers and a white barn owl flying over an English meadow. It is a 36x36x1.5 inches, oil on canvas. A bridleway leads in from the left with a bank of cow parsley to the right. A white barn owl flies over the path. Behind her you see a blue sky and the slope of the South Downs with the patches of woodland through which ancient drover’s paths lead to the top. In May, cow parsley lines the edges of fields like lace and looks like the month is dressed up in its best dress – which is appropriate as this is when nature is most active in reproducing itself. This is an actual landscape that I visit often and is a place that has magic in it for me. I wanted to pay tribute to this area (near Ditchling) and also to help highlight the efforts of the ‘donturbanisethedowns.com’ movement who are trying to prevent this area being built over

Artist Biography:

Gill Bustamante is a professional artist based in East Sussex who creates large semi-abstract landscape, seascape and wildlife paintings in oil on canvas. Her painting style is very distinct and often fuses art-nouveau, impressionist and semi-abstract techniques with traditional portraiture that reflect her love of nature, animals, birds and the flora and fauna of the landscapes around her. She loves the ancient landscapes of England and her paintings often reflect the magical elements that such landscapes have. Gill’s main working method has been the development of a painting style she terms ‘memory impressionism’. This method involves going walking somewhere, looking at and absorbing the things she sees and experiences, and then returning home to her studio to try and capture an echo or essence of the place from memory - including any wildlife she may have seen. By this method, she captures precise moments in times at different seasons and the feeling she has about them. Gill completed a fine art degree in Brighton in 1983 and has painted since she was three.
